With PC gamers finally able to log on and play Electronic Arts' SimCity, the studio head answers the question that everyone has been asking.
We put a ton of effort into making our simulation and graphics engines more detailed than ever and to give players lively and responsive cities. We also made innovative use of servers to move aspects of the simulation into the cloud to support region play and social features. Here’s just a few:
We keep the simulation state of the region up to date for all players. Even when playing solo, this keeps the interactions between cities up to date in a shared view of the world.
Players who want to reach the peak of each specialization can count on surrounding cities to provide services or resources, even workers. As other players build, your city can draw on their resources.
Our Great Works rely on contributions from multiple cities in a region. Connected services keep each player’s contributions updated and the progression on Great Works moving ahead.
All of our social world features - world challenges, world events, world leaderboards and world achievements - use our servers to update the status of all cities.
Our servers handle gifts between players.
We’ve created a dynamic supply and demand model for trading by keeping a Global Market updated with changing demands on key resources.
We update each city’s visual representation as well. If you visit another player’s city, you’ll see the most up to date visual status.
We even check to make sure that all the cities saved are legit, so that the region play, leaderboards, challenges and achievements rewards and status have integrity.